========= The Beginning ============
1. Click the big castle in the center of the map, [b]The Hall of Heros[/b]
2. In the very back-right corner, you'll see a familiar character. Click him!
3. Hey! It's our old friend again. Looks like he has a new job-- Janitor. Click that button that's next to him.
---> Hm, nothing happened.
4. Oh well, Now click the [b]Altadorian Archives[/b], then go into the doorway on the right.
5. Click the book that is under one of the table legs and balancing it.
---> Hm, we're going to have to replace it...
6. Now go to the [url=http://www.neopets.com/altador/quarry.phtml][b]QUARRY[/b][/url]. And find a rock that'll be suitable. Stumped? [url=http://img141.imageshack.us/img141/1456/therock2fh.gif]Here.[/url]
---> Aha! A good replacement for that book...
7. Go back to the [b]Altadorian Archives[/b] and click that same book again.
---> We can access the book now! (Located near the top-right part of the scene)
8. You can read the prologue from that book now.
---> Advance a page by clicking the top-right of the book, go back by clicking the top-left.
[color=blue][b]*** Page 1~3 Acquired! ***[/b][/color] (out of 53 pages)
9. Go back to the Janitor in [b]The Hall of Heros[/b] and talk to him.
---> Hm. We're going to need something to help oil some gears...
10. Click each statue until you find a [i]bottle of oil & a rag[/i]
---> Note: Location is different for each person. Perhaps you should write where you found it, just in case.
11. Once you've found it, go back to the Janitor and click the button again.
---> The ceiling opens up! Let there be LIGHT!
